The legend of Santa Claus sprung from the story of a kind hearted man named Nicholas. Having heard of a poor man who was about to send the eldest of his three daughters on the streets to become a prostitute, Nichols secretly threw bags of gold in the window of the man's house, saving the family and providing the girl with a dowry. While tossing the last bag in the window, Nicholas was discovered and became the patron saint of girls without a dowry. The story of his generosity become associated with Christmas and is the basis for our modern Santa Claus.
